I appreciate that. I'll check that out. In the mean time, I came up with 
a bash script to fix the issue with the ones I've already downloaded. In 
case anyone else is interested or needs it, two simply commands run in 
the same directory as the index.html files:

> rename 's/index\.html\?page=([0-9]+)\&/index$1.html/' *
> sed -Ei 's/index\.html\?page=([0-9]+)\&amp;/index\1.html/' *.html

>>  From the main 'index.html' page, if you click on 'page 2', the address
>> bar reflects that it is displaying 'index.html?page=2&' but the actual
>> content is still that of the original 'index.html' page. I can double
>> click on the 'index.html?page=2&' file itself in the file manager and it
>> does, in fact, display the page associated with page 2.
